What is Polymer and Polymerization?
The word Polymer is come from the Greek word 'Polymeres'. Polymer is a Heavy Chain molecule having high molecular weight. Polymer is made up with small unit and the small units are known as Monomers which are with low molecular weight. From the word 'Polymer' we can see that it is the combination of both 'Poly' and 'mers' (i.e Monomers) So, Adding of Monomers one by one Polymers are made.
Polymerization is that process through which polymer is made from Monomers. It is the process where the monomer units are added one by one to form the Polymer unit.
In 1907, the introduction of Bakelite, the first polymer started the age of polymer. Harman Francis Mark , an Austrian-American chemist was known as the father of Polymer science. Here are so many examples of Polymers that are used in our daily life. PVC i.e Poly Vinyl Chloride, is a polymer which is made from the monomer Vinyl Chloride. Types of Polymerization
- Addition Polymerization:-
It is the type of Polymerization where the monomer unit are added one by one and form the Polymers. This type of Polymerization is completed through three steps and they are-
(a) Initiation,
(b) Propagation,
(c) Termination
During the time of initiation, the Polymerization starts by adding the monomer units. During the Propagation phase, monomers are further added with previously made polymer and elongate it's chain. After the completion of adding monomer units, then the Polymerization process is stopped. This phase is known as Termination phase.
This type of Polymerization is also known as Chain growth Polymerization.

2. Condensation Polymerization:-
It is the type of Polymerization where the monomer units comes contact with each other and after coming they react in a point and then gives some by product after reaction.
In this Polymerization, the monomer unit having two reactive group is able to react once. But, the monomer with two reactive group can react more than one time and is suitable for forming the fiber.
This type of Polymerization is also known as Step growth Polymerization.
